Statement of Faith

Covenant High School embraces the Bible as the inerrant, infallible Word of God: “All Scripture is God breathed and is useful for teaching, rebuking, correcting and training in righteousness, so that the man of God may be thoroughly equipped for every good work” (2 Timothy 3:16). The school regards the Westminster Confession of Faith as a faithful summary of the central truths of Scripture. Key tenets from the Westminster Confession include the following:

  • God is a Triune God – the Father, Son and Holy Spirit. 
  • The Bible is God’s infallible and authoritative Word to man. It is the only standard by which faith and practice are to be measured. 
  • The chief end of man is to glorify God and enjoy him forever. 
  • Man is created in the image of God. Through his relationship to Adam, man is a sinner by nature and does himself sin. He is thus alienated from God, his neighbor and the world. All are sinners. 
  • Jesus Christ is the only Savior of sinners, the only way to the Father. He died as a substitute for sinners and was raised from the dead so that they might be reconciled to God. 
  • Eternal life is a gift that is received through faith in Jesus alone. Eternal life is neither deserved by anyone, nor can it be earned by good deeds.
